Ex-gratia to flood-victims our priority: UP chief secretary

Lucknow, Sep 9 (UNI) Uttar Pradesh Chief Secretary Atul Kumar Gupta today directed officials to disperse ex-gratia to flood-victims for houses and agricultural purposes on priority.

Mr Gupta, while reviewing the flood relief works at a meeting in Annexe here, said the officers should complete their survey soon so that financial help could be provided to those affected people as soon as possible.

Giving details, the chief secretary said that so far Rs 383 crore have been been allotted to the flood-hit districts, while more money would be given for the rescue and relief operations when needed.

For rennovation of dams, roads, health centers, schools etc, the related departments should complete their survey and act accordingly, Mr Gupta added.

The rennovation work would be carried out from Calamity Relief Funds, he informed.

Principal Secretary (finance) Anoop Mishra, Principal Secretary (revenue) Balwinder Kumar, Principal Secretary (agriculture) Shri Krishna and Relief Commissioner G K Tandon were also present in the meeting.
